Bus, Metro and, public bicycle system

Metro Line 6 (Stop: Boissière) is 2 minutes from the apartment, take a left exiting the building and then another left, walk 50 meters and cross the avenue. Metro line 9: Trocadero is a 5 minute walk from the apartment. Turn left exiting the building and then right, and walk until the large square. This is also one of the most famous squares in Paris, with several cafés a views of the Eiffel Tower. Metro Line 2: Place Victor Hugo: Turn right exiting the building and at the intersection take Avenue Raymond Poincaré, walk it for 5 minutes. Public Bicycle Stations: Velib metropole website

Bus, Metro, and Public Bicycle System

Buses 22 and 30 go all along Avenue Kleber (the large avenue next to the apartment. These buses do a portion of paris from East-West. Furthermore, there is bus 82 a 2 minute walk from the apartment (next to Hotel Baltimore) that takes you to Jardin Du Luxembourg.
